How to use Object.keys() method In Javascript
- We can get the size of the javascript object with the help of Object.keys() method.
- Create an object variable and assign values to it
- Create a variable that shows the size
- Call the Object.keys(object-name).length and assign it to the variable (in step 2).
Syntax:
Object.keys(object_name);
Example: To get the size of a javascript object by Object.keys() method.
JavaScript
let object1= { "rajnish" : "singh" , "sanjeev" : "sharma" , "suraj" : "agrahari" , "yash" : "khandelwal" }; let count= Object.keys(object1).length; console.log(count); |
Output
4
